vramscope attaches to GPU worker pods to sample memory allocation. It runs with elevated node access, so treat every change as security-relevant. Do not enable full-heap dumps outside the isolated Kestrelpine cluster; dumps may contain tenant tensors. Sampling intervals below 100ms have caused driver stalls — don't lower them during incidents. All profiling sessions are logged and auto-expire after two hours. Before approving any deployment change, verify it matches the baseline configuration shown below.

config for yajep-tafof:
[rusath]
team = julmir
access_code = ac_fe37fd
host = rusath.novactech.test
port = 8000
owner = pelmir.weneth
peer = oliwyn.olvarqdyn.internal

## v4.2.1 — Log sampling for ChatterRelay

ChatterRelay now samples debug and info logs at 1:50 by default. Plugin authors: log volume from your hooks counts toward the sample budget. Use the `force_log` flag sparingly; abuse triggers throttling. Error and warning levels remain unsampled. Sampling rates are configurable per plugin namespace via the manifest. Breaking: the old `verbose_mode` flag is removed — migrate before v4.3. Questions on sampling policy or exemption requests go to the maintainer below.

account owner for fajep-yagef: Kasix Eliiel

Quick refresher for support: Pinwheel follows semver, but minor bumps can still shift padding tokens, so always check the changelog before telling a customer "it's safe to upgrade." Each consuming team gets a service account that pins them to a release channel (stable, canary, or frozen). If a customer reports mismatched versions, pull their channel assignment from the Pinwheel registry first. The registry API is internal-only and needs authentication for channel lookups. The support team's shared key is below.

API key for fahip-kahip: zpat23_XiJGUHz5xfaAtaIqUkus0rh

If a RateLens operator account gets locked mid-scan, the parity checker will keep queuing hotel snapshots but stop publishing alerts. New team members should first confirm the lockout in the RateLens admin console, then trigger the standard recovery flow. The flow requires the on-call lead's approval plus the shared recovery passphrase. Approval requests go through the usual escalation channel. The current recovery passphrase is listed on the line below.

strongbox words: wenix-ulador